I'm using an iPad1 with 64GB of memory, around 15GB of it free. Using the latest-and-greatest version of xFeed (4.0 I believe).
One RSS feed in particular is giving me this problem: Astronomy Picture of the day at http://apod.nasa.gov/apod.rss
I get the list of updates just fine, and have no problem viewing the APOD of the current day.
When I try to view the APODs from earlier days I continue to be shown the one from the current day. So, for instance, if I try to view the entry from 5/14/2013 I am shown the entry from that day, but when I tap on Read More to see the entire entry I am returned to the full entry from today, 5/21/2013. Using the down arrow above the daily photo takes me to the previous day's entry, but when I tap on Read More I am again shown the current day's entry.
This only happens with the APOD site (so far), so I have no idea if this is a problem with their site or with xFeed. But any help would be appreciated!
